UNICORN BROADSHEET SERIES 1
Unicorn Press: np, 1968-1970. Hardcover. Very Good. Item #22-9709
Ten broadsides, varied designs, sizes ranging from 15 x 11 to 19 x 12.5", loose in quarter grey green cloth and boards. Faint smudge on one and faint ink mark on another (from printing process?), tiny bit of fraying else fine. Contributors include: Gary Snyder "A Curse On The Men In Washington, Pentagon"; Robert Bly "In A Boat On Big Stone Lake"; James Tate "The Torches"; Kenneth Rexroth "All Year Long"; David Meltzer "For Raymond Chandler"; George Hitchcock "Song of Expectancy"; Thomas Merton "St. Maedoc"; Teo Savory "Thoughts After Visiting The Library At Lenox"; Jerome Rothenberg "Polish Anecdote The Banquet"; James Tipton "Conversations". Limitation inside rear cover reads "Number 27 of thirty sets of ten broadsides each signed by the poets. Unicorn Press 1968-1970". Only nine of the broadsides are signed as Thomas Merton died in 1968. An important example of 1960s small press printings. How many of these wonderful sets have survived intact? SCARCE.
